The Perfect Pairing: Groceries and Music for 6-Year-Olds

Introduction: As parents, we are always on the lookout for ways to engage our children in activities that are both fun and educational. One ideal combination that comes to mind is grocery shopping and music. In this blog post, we will explore the benefits of introducing music and dance into the lives of 6-year-olds while incorporating it into our everyday routines, specifically during grocery shopping trips. 1. Music and Cognitive Development: At the age of 6, children are actively developing their cognitive abilities. Music can play a significant role in enhancing their cognitive skills, such as memory, attention span, and problem-solving abilities. By incorporating music into their lives, we provide an enjoyable way for them to exercise their brainpower while grocery shopping. 2. Grocery Shopping Games: Make your trip to the grocery store an interactive experience by playing musical games. Challenge your child to find items that start with a specific letter or sing a song related to the items in their shopping cart. This playful approach will not only keep them entertained but also nurture their creativity and language skills. 3. Dance and Physical Development: Music is a natural motivator for movement, and dance is a great way to channel that energy constructively. Integrating dance into a grocery shopping trip allows children to express themselves physically, improve their coordination, balance, and motor skills while grooving to their favorite tunes. 4. Musical Grocery Lists: Transform your ordinary grocery lists into musical masterpieces. Instead of writing down items on a paper, create a rhythmic and catchy list together. For example, turn the usual 'apples, bananas, broccoli' into a fun chant like "apples, apples! bananas, bananas! broccoli, broccoli!" Not only will this make the task of shopping more enjoyable, but it will also build their memorization skills and help reinforce knowledge of new vocabulary. 5. Learn about Healthy Eating: While browsing the aisles, take advantage of the opportunity to educate your child about nutritious food choices through music and dance. Incorporate songs related to fruits, vegetables, or even on the importance of a balanced diet. By instilling positive associations with healthy eating habits, you're setting the foundation for a lifelong love of nutritious food. Conclusion: Introducing music and dance into your 6-year-old's life can be a valuable and enjoyable experience for both parent and child. By combining these arts with routine activities like grocery shopping, you'll not only enhance their cognitive and physical development but also create lasting memories together. So, the next time you head to the grocery store, remember to bring along your favorite tunes and get ready to dance through the aisles!
